Why Choose Custom Fuel Hoses?
One of the primary reasons to opt for custom fuel hoses is the ability to design them according to specific requirements. Standard hoses are typically manufactured in fixed lengths and diameters, which may not always suit the unique layout of a vehicle's fuel system or a particular equipment's configuration. Custom hoses can be fabricated to precise specifications, ensuring a perfect fit and optimal performance.
Additionally, custom fuel hoses can be designed to withstand the specific environmental conditions they will encounter. This is particularly important for applications in extreme temperatures, high pressures, or hazardous environments. By choosing the right materials and construction techniques, manufacturers can create hoses that provide enhanced resistance to factors such as abrasion, corrosion, and fuel degradation.
Material Considerations
The choice of materials is one of the most crucial aspects of designing a custom fuel hose. Common materials used for fuel hoses include rubber, PVC, and various thermoplastics. Each material offers distinct advantages and disadvantages based on the type of fuel being transported, the temperature range, and the pressure requirements.
For instance, fuel hoses made from fluoroelastomers are highly resistant to a wide range of fuels, making them ideal for high-performance applications in motorsports. On the other hand, silicone hoses are often used in situations where flexibility and resistance to extreme temperature fluctuations are necessary.
Safety Features
Safety is paramount when it comes to fuel systems. Any leaks or failures in the fuel hose can lead to catastrophic consequences, including fire hazards and environmental damage. Custom fuel hoses can incorporate various safety features to mitigate these risks. Reinforcements, such as steel braiding or spiral winding, can enhance the hose's burst strength and flexibility, making it more robust against the stresses of the fuel delivery system.
Furthermore, custom hoses can be designed with specific end fittings or connectors that ensure a secure and leak-free connection. The precision in the design and construction of custom hoses plays a significant role in minimizing the risk of fuel leaks, thereby enhancing safety and reliability.
Applications of Custom Fuel Hoses
Custom fuel hoses are used in a wide range of applications across different industries. In the automotive market, they are often employed in high-performance vehicles, classic cars, and modified engines where standard hoses may not suffice. Maintaining optimal fuel flow and pressure is crucial for achieving maximum engine performance, making custom solutions vital.
In aviation, custom fuel hoses are engineered to meet stringent regulatory standards and performance requirements. The unique demands of aircraft fuel systems necessitate hoses that can handle high pressures and resist jet fuel's corrosive properties.
Additionally, marine applications require custom fuel hoses that can withstand salty conditions and fluctuating temperatures. Ensuring reliable fuel delivery in boats and other maritime vehicles is critical for safety and performance on the water.
